ACCOUNTANT, ASSOC
Job Summary:
Supports treasury operations, including daily cash flow monitoring and FX exposure forecasting, while managing e‑invoice preparation and compliance in accordance with regulatory requirements.
The position reports to Treasury Supervisor and Accounting Manager
- Monitor daily cash flow, perform monthly & quarterly cash flow projections and FX Exposure forecast.
- Ensure proper recording of inter-company and non-trade AR/AP transactions.
- Prepare periodical reports to Statistic Department, Central Bank and MIDA
- Prepare and submission of e-invoice for inter-company and monitoring of e-invoice process to ensure compliance with IRB requirement.
- Liaison person for payment related issue between AP share service team and supplier.
- Perform reconciliation and account analysis and resolve issues, if any.
- Ensure compliance to SOX requirement
Requirements:
- Bachelor in Accounting.
- Preferably with 2 to 3 years’ relevant experience in auditing field is an added advantage.
- Knowledge of MASB Approved Accounting Standards for Private Entities,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P), SOX and e-invoice are essential.
- Exposure to computerized accounting systems is essential (e.g Oracle System) and AI (e.g copilot)
- Knowledge of relevant local taxation and pension/ social contribution regulations and development is preferred.
- Effective communication skills are crucial.
- Must be organized and adaptable.
- Trouble shooting and creative problem-solving skills.
- Experience in completing process simplification projects in previous/current job/roles
- Knowledge of AI
